What Makes a Rental Application Stand Out to Landlords

What Makes a Rental Application Stand Out to Landlords

In competitive rental markets, landlords often receive multiple applications for the same property, making it important for applicants to stand out. Beyond meeting basic requirements, factors like documentation quality, financial stability, and communication speed can strongly influence the final decision. Understanding what landlords prioritize can help renters improve their chances of approval.
